Output 8cb08396a069f817cba3a0cbbe79331248e1006a6f584a18de79cbd9a34412ec:0

value
8894825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8f71b7022cbbf71e0f614cb3ab7fbf84e358f1a OP_EQUAL
address
3MUDuHbe4hvNq7aGnehtm3AQJFG8p5tq4m
transaction
8cb08396a069f817cba3a0cbbe79331248e1006a6f584a18de79cbd9a34412ec
spent
true